Once the account setup is done by your web hosting company, you get an email containing all the important information related to your web hosting package. This information is very important and needs to be saved for future reference. In the email you also get the control panel login details created for you by your web host. So now let’s see how to use cPanel and the method to logon to your control panel.
First you need to open your favorite web browser. Now there are two ways to access your cPanel. One is completely secured and the second way is a bit insecure. The correct and safe way for logging into cPanel is https://yourdomainname.com:2083/ or your use your IP Address https://ipaddress:2083/ when you logon to cPanel in this manner you will be prompted or warned for the security certificate not matching. There is nothing to worry about this. You need to accept the certificate and continue…
In the second method you can access the control panel i.e. cPanel by using                        http://yourdomainname.com:2082/ or you can use this way http://ipaddress:2082/
There are hardly any warnings that are displayed when you logon to cPanel using this method. Most of the people use this method to logon to cpanel however it is not as safe as the first method is. All this information along with the cPanel username and password plus the server IP address is included in he Welcome Email sent to you by your Web Host.
